Tokenization platform Fortunafi has raised funding at a valuation of $48 million and unveiled its stablecoin protocol Reservoir.

Fortunafi, a real-world asset (RWA) tokenization platform, announced that it has raised $9.51 million in strategic and seed funding rounds and also unveiled a new stablecoin protocol called Reservoir.

Investors in this funding round included Shima Capital, Manifold, Jordan Fish (aka Cobie), Ari Litan of LayerZero Labs, Austin Green of Llama, Evanss6 and Scott Lewis, and Fortunafi.

The latest strategic funding round worth $3.16 million closed last December and the seed round worth $6.35 million closed in October 2021. Both rounds were officially announced today, Fortunafi founder and CEO Nick Garcia told The Block.

Both rounds consisted of shares with token warrants, and the latest round valued Fortunafi at $48.165 million, Garcia said.

What is Fortunapi?

Fortunafi was founded in 2020 and initially operated as one of the original issuers of tokenization platform Centrifuge. Fortunafi said it has tokenized more than $15 million in private debt and institutional loans through partnerships with MakerDAO, Aave, and others.

Last December, as part of its move away from Centrifuge, it developed its own tokenization platform called Tokenized Asset Protocol (TAP), Garcia said. TAP is a cross-chain tokenization platform that allows users to natively mint real-world assets across multiple layer 1 and layer 2 networks.

Fortunafi plans to soon launch a real-asset index token in collaboration with Index Coop.

TAP currently operates on the Canto, Blast and Arbitrum networks and plans to support more blockchains such as Base and Berachain, Garcia said. Currently, the platform’s total valuation is pegged at $7 million, but Garcia expects TVL to grow with the launch of five new tokenized products.

Fortunafi’s new stablecoin protocol: Reservoir

Fortunafi also launched Reservoir, a new stablecoin protocol today. Garcia said Reservoir is scheduled to launch in June and is a separate entity from Fortunafi.

Reservoir, a stablecoin protocol, will offer users a variety of monetization products based on digital and real-world assets. “Reservoir exists to offer very attractive yields so that users can enjoy the benefits of DeFi across a variety of decentralized protocols that only require a wallet and an internet connection,” said Garcia.

“Native integration is possible across all chains.” Once launched, Reservoir’s native stablecoin rUSD will be available across DeFi platforms. rUSD “will be backed by a balance sheet of both digital and real assets,” Garcia said.

Fortunafi currently employs 10 people, a few of whom are moving to support the Reservoir, Garcia said. He added that he plans to keep the team going for the foreseeable future.
